The Importance of Boundaries
Boundaries are the invisible lines that define our limits. They help us protect our time, energy, and emotional health. Without them, we risk burnout, stress, and strained relationships. Healthy boundaries allow us to recharge and maintain a positive mindset, which is essential for both our personal and professional lives.
Setting Boundaries at Work
Define Your Work Hours: Clearly establish your working hours and communicate them to your colleagues. Avoid checking emails or taking calls outside of these hours unless absolutely necessary.
Learn to Say No: It's okay to decline additional projects or tasks if your plate is already full. Politely but firmly explain that you cannot take on more work without compromising quality.
Take Breaks: Regular breaks during the workday are vital. Step away from your desk, take a walk, or meditate. This helps you stay focused and reduces stress.
Delegate Tasks: If you're in a position to do so, delegate tasks to others. Trusting your team not only lightens your load but also fosters a collaborative environment.
Setting Boundaries at Home
Communicate Openly: Discuss your needs and limits with family members. Let them know when you need alone time or help with household responsibilities.
Schedule Personal Time: Allocate specific times for self-care activities like exercise, reading, or hobbies. Treat these appointments with the same importance as work meetings.
Limit Technology Use: Create tech-free zones or times, especially during family meals or bedtime. This fosters meaningful connections and reduces distractions.
Seek Support: Don't hesitate to ask for help from your partner, family, or friends. Sharing responsibilities ensures that no one feels overwhelmed.
